aboutsummaryrefslogtreecommitdiff
path: root/gcc/regclass.c
AgeCommit message (Expand)AuthorFilesLines
2002-07-15[multiple changes]Michael Matz1-1/+19
2002-06-16regclass.c (globalize_reg): Update regs_invalidated_by_call.Richard Henderson1-0/+1
2002-06-13emit-rtl.c (static_regno_reg_rtx): Define.Jeff Law1-2/+7
2002-06-04Merge from pch-branch up to tag pch-commit-20020603.Geoffrey Keating1-6/+3
2002-05-23bb-reorder.c (make_reorder_chain, [...]): Use FOR_EACH_BB macros to iterate o...Zdenek Dvorak1-8/+6
2002-05-16Revert "Basic block renumbering removal", and two followup patches.Richard Henderson1-6/+7
2002-05-16Basic block renumbering removal.Zdenek Dvorak1-7/+6
2002-05-09read-rtl.c: Fix formatting.Kazu Hirata1-33/+33
2002-03-03emit-rtl.c, [...]: Remove all #ifndef REAL_ARITHMETIC blocks...Zack Weinberg1-12/+0
2002-02-19i386.md ("mmx_uavgv8qi3"): Use const_vector.Aldy Hernandez1-0/+1
2002-01-29expr.c (force_operand): Ignore flag_pic for detecting pic address loads.Richard Henderson1-1/+1
2002-01-15read-rtl.c: Fix formatting.Kazu Hirata1-9/+9
2002-01-10read-rtl.c: Fix formatting.Kazu Hirata1-4/+4
2001-12-27collect2.c (is_ctor_dtor): Const-ify.Kaveh R. Ghazi1-1/+1
2001-12-17Implement MODE_BASE_REG_CLASSNick Clifton1-15/+18
2001-11-26* regclass.c (choose_hard_reg_mode): Handle vector arguments.Aldy Hernandez1-0/+20
2001-10-18emit-rtl.c (gen_reg_rtx): Also reallocate reg_decl array.Richard Kenner1-0/+18
2001-10-11alias.c: Remove uses of "register" specifier in declarations of arguments and...Stan Shebs1-31/+31
2001-10-09c-common.c: Fix comment typos.Kazu Hirata1-1/+1
2001-10-07builtins.c (expand_builtin_setjmp_receiver): Const-ify.Kaveh R. Ghazi1-2/+2
2001-08-23regclass.c (init_reg_sets_1): Don't assume cost 2 within a register class.Richard Henderson1-1/+1
2001-08-22Makefile.in, [...]: replace "GNU CC" with "GCC".Lars Brinkhoff1-12/+12
2001-08-19* regclass.c (fix_register): Fix typo.Richard Henderson1-1/+1
2001-08-18flow.c (mark_regs_live_at_end): Use regs_invalidated_by_call.Richard Henderson1-1/+1
2001-08-12gcc.c: Fix comment formatting.Kazu Hirata1-4/+4
2001-08-02regclass.c (call_really_used_regs): Conditionally define.Richard Henderson1-5/+10
2001-08-01regclass.c (call_really_used_regs): New array for registers which are actuall...Andrew MacLeod1-1/+15
2001-07-30flow.c (mark_set_1): Use REG_FREQ_FROM_BB.Jan Hubicka1-5/+2
2001-07-29[multiple changes]Daniel Berlin1-1/+4
2001-07-20* regclass.c (N_REG_INTS): Use only 32 bits per element.Richard Henderson1-2/+3
2001-07-16regclass.c (init_reg_sets): Use only 32 bits per initializer from int_reg_cla...Richard Henderson1-2/+3
2001-07-16hard-reg-set.h (regs_invalidated_by_call): Declare.Richard Henderson1-1/+38
2001-06-22flow.c (mark_set_1, [...]): compute REG_FREQ using bb->frequency.Jan Hubicka1-15/+14
2001-06-22regs.h (struct reg_info_def): Add freq field.Jan Hubicka1-0/+3
2001-05-09regclass.c (scan_one_insn): Update REG_N_REFS when optimizing handling of two...Alexandre Oliva1-1/+6
2001-04-13Makefile.in (ssa.o, regclass.o): Depend on $(EXPR_H).Kaveh R. Ghazi1-0/+1
2001-03-02print-rtl.c (print_rtx): Cast enums to int for comparison.John David Anglin1-13/+18
2001-02-19regclass.c (contains_reg_of_mode): Make global.Jan Hubicka1-11/+23
2001-02-14regclass.c (init_reg_sets_1): Reinstall the optimization of move_cost togethe...Jan Hubicka1-32/+65
2001-02-14* regclass.c (init_reg_sets_1): Revert last two changes.Richard Henderson1-65/+32
2001-02-13* regclass.c (init_reg_sets_1): Silence warning.Jan Hubicka1-48/+52
2001-02-12regclass.c (init_reg_sets_1): Optimize calculation of move_cost arrays.Jan Hubicka1-27/+56
2001-01-19regclass.c (max_set_parallel): New variable.Richard Kenner1-1/+16
2001-01-02tm.texi (REGISTER_MOVE_COST): Add a mode argument.Alexandre Oliva1-44/+48
2000-11-29function.h (emit_status): Delete member regno_pointer_flag and rename regno_p...John David Anglin1-11/+11
2000-11-10alpha.c (check_float_value): Use memcpy, not bcopy.Kaveh R. Ghazi1-3/+3
2000-11-07alias.c [...] (init_alias_analysis, [...]): Use memset () instead of bzero ().Joseph Myers1-6/+6
2000-09-14calls.c (precompute_register_parameters): Use COSTS_N_INSNS, not 2.Richard Henderson1-1/+1
2000-08-28local-alloc.c (requires_inout): Don't use reserved range for EXTRA_CONSTRAINT...Richard Henderson1-14/+9
2000-08-08* regclass.c (choose_hard_reg_mode): Iterate over all CC modes.Richard Henderson1-3/+5